
UK economy shrinks another 0.1% in disaster for Rachel Reeves express.co.uk
The UK economy shrank by 0.1% in May, dealing a fresh blow to Chancellor Rachel Reeves. Figures published by the Office for National Statistics (ONS) on Friday showed that gross domestic product (GDP) fell, missing City forecasts which had predicted a 0.1% increase.
